Jonathan Wade Pennington, Chief Accounting Officer of FB Financial Corp, reports the withholding of 143 shares for tax purposes related to vested restricted stock units.

Summary

  • On April 1, 2025, FB Financial Corp's Chief Accounting Officer, Jonathan Wade Pennington, had 143 shares of common stock withheld by the issuer for tax purposes.
  • This was due to the vesting of a portion of previously reported restricted stock units.
  • Following the transaction, Pennington directly owns 5,260 shares of FB Financial Corp stock.
